#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""QGIS Unit tests for QgsPalLabeling: base suite of render check tests
Class is meant to be inherited by classes that test different labeling outputs
See <qgis-src-dir>/tests/testdata/labeling/README.rst for description.
.. note:: This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the License, or
(at your option) any later version.
"""
__author__ = 'Larry Shaffer'
__date__ = '07/16/2013'
__copyright__ = 'Copyright 2013, The QGIS Project'
# This will get replaced with a git SHA1 when you do a git archive
__revision__ = '$Format:%H$'
import qgis # NOQA
import os
from qgis.PyQt.QtCore import Qt, QPointF
from qgis.PyQt.QtGui import QFont
from qgis.core import QgsPalLayerSettings
from utilities import svgSymbolsPath
# noinspection PyPep8Naming
class TestPointBase(object):
def __init__(self):
"""Dummy assignments, intended to be overridden in subclasses"""
self.lyr = QgsPalLayerSettings()
""":type: QgsPalLayerSettings"""
# noinspection PyArgumentList
self._TestFont = QFont() # will become a standard test font
self._Pal = None
""":type: QgsPalLabeling"""
self._Canvas = None
""":type: QgsMapCanvas"""
# custom mismatches per group/test (should not mask any needed anomaly)
# e.g. self._Mismatches['TestClassName'] = 300
# check base output class's checkTest() or sublcasses for any defaults
self._Mismatches = dict()
# custom color tolerances per group/test: 1 - 20 (0 default, 20 max)
# (should not mask any needed anomaly)
# e.g. self._ColorTols['TestClassName'] = 10
# check base output class's checkTest() or sublcasses for any defaults
self._ColorTols = dict()
# noinspection PyMethodMayBeStatic
def checkTest(self, **kwargs):
"""Intended to be overridden in subclasses"""
pass
def test_default_label(self):
# Default label placement, with text size in points
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 776
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_text_size_map_unit(self):
# Label text size in map units
self.lyr.fontSizeInMapUnits = True
font = QFont(self._TestFont)
font.setPointSizeF(460)
self.lyr.textFont = font
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 776
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_text_color(self):
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 774
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
# Label color change
self.lyr.textColor = Qt.blue
self.checkTest()
def test_background_rect(self):
self._Mismatches['TestComposerImageVsCanvasPoint'] = 800
self._Mismatches['TestComposerImagePoint'] = 800
self.lyr.shapeDraw = True
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 776
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 1
self.checkTest()
def test_background_rect_w_offset(self):
# Label rectangular background
self._Mismatches['TestComposerImageVsCanvasPoint'] = 800
self._Mismatches['TestComposerImagePoint'] = 800
# verify fix for issues
# http://hub.qgis.org/issues/9057
# http://gis.stackexchange.com/questions/86900
self.lyr.fontSizeInMapUnits = True
font = QFont(self._TestFont)
font.setPointSizeF(460)
self.lyr.textFont = font
self.lyr.shapeDraw = True
self.lyr.shapeOffsetUnits = QgsPalLayerSettings.MapUnits
self.lyr.shapeOffset = QPointF(-2900.0, -450.0)
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 774
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_background_svg(self):
# Label SVG background
self.lyr.fontSizeInMapUnits = True
font = QFont(self._TestFont)
font.setPointSizeF(460)
self.lyr.textFont = font
self.lyr.shapeDraw = True
self.lyr.shapeType = QgsPalLayerSettings.ShapeSVG
svg = os.path.join(
svgSymbolsPath(), 'backgrounds', 'background_square.svg')
self.lyr.shapeSVGFile = svg
self.lyr.shapeSizeUnits = QgsPalLayerSettings.MapUnits
self.lyr.shapeSizeType = QgsPalLayerSettings.SizeBuffer
self.lyr.shapeSize = QPointF(100.0, 0.0)
self._Mismatches['TestComposerPdfVsComposerPoint'] = 580
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 776
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_background_svg_w_offset(self):
# Label SVG background
self.lyr.fontSizeInMapUnits = True
font = QFont(self._TestFont)
font.setPointSizeF(460)
self.lyr.textFont = font
self.lyr.shapeDraw = True
self.lyr.shapeType = QgsPalLayerSettings.ShapeSVG
svg = os.path.join(
svgSymbolsPath(), 'backgrounds', 'background_square.svg')
self.lyr.shapeSVGFile = svg
self.lyr.shapeSizeUnits = QgsPalLayerSettings.MapUnits
self.lyr.shapeSizeType = QgsPalLayerSettings.SizeBuffer
self.lyr.shapeSize = QPointF(100.0, 0.0)
self.lyr.shapeOffsetUnits = QgsPalLayerSettings.MapUnits
self.lyr.shapeOffset = QPointF(-2850.0, 500.0)
self._Mismatches['TestComposerPdfVsComposerPoint'] = 760
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 776
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_partials_labels_enabled(self):
# Set Big font size
font = QFont(self._TestFont)
font.setPointSizeF(84)
self.lyr.textFont = font
# Enable partials labels
self._Pal.setShowingPartialsLabels(True)
self._Pal.saveEngineSettings()
self._Mismatches['TestCanvasPoint'] = 779
self._ColorTols['TestComposerPdfPoint'] =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_partials_labels_disabled(self):
# Set Big font size
font = QFont(self._TestFont)
font.setPointSizeF(84)
self.lyr.textFont = font
# Disable partials labels
self._Pal.setShowingPartialsLabels(False)
self._Pal.saveEngineSettings()
self.checkTest()
def test_buffer(self):
# Label with buffer
self.lyr.bufferDraw = True
self.lyr.bufferSize = 2
self.checkTest()
def test_shadow(self):
# Label with shadow
self.lyr.shadowDraw = True
self.lyr.shadowOffsetDist = 2
self.lyr.shadowTransparency = 0
self.checkTest()
# noinspection PyPep8Naming
class TestLineBase(object):
def __init__(self):
"""Dummy assignments, intended to be overridden in subclasses"""
self.lyr = QgsPalLayerSettings()
""":type: QgsPalLayerSettings"""
# noinspection PyArgumentList
self._TestFont = QFont() # will become a standard test font
self._Pal = None
""":type: QgsPalLabeling"""
self._Canvas = None
""":type: QgsMapCanvas"""
# custom mismatches per group/test (should not mask any needed anomaly)
# e.g. self._Mismatches['TestClassName'] = 300
# check base output class's checkTest() or sublcasses for any defaults
self._Mismatches = dict()
# custom color tolerances per group/test: 1 - 20 (0 default, 20 max)
# (should not mask any needed anomaly)
# e.g. self._ColorTols['TestClassName'] = 10
# check base output class's checkTest() or sublcasses for any defaults
self._ColorTols = dict()
# noinspection PyMethodMayBeStatic
def checkTest(self, **kwargs):
"""Intended to be overridden in subclasses"""
pass
def test_line_placement_above_line_orientation(self):
# Line placement, above, follow line orientation
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Line
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.AboveLine
self.checkTest()
def test_line_placement_online(self):
# Line placement, on line
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Line
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.OnLine
self.checkTest()
def test_line_placement_below_line_orientation(self):
# Line placement, below, follow line orientation
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Line
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.BelowLine
self.checkTest()
def test_line_placement_above_map_orientation(self):
# Line placement, above, follow map orientation
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Line
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.AboveLine | QgsPalLayerSettings.MapOrientation
self.checkTest()
def test_line_placement_below_map_orientation(self):
# Line placement, below, follow map orientation
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Line
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.BelowLine | QgsPalLayerSettings.MapOrientation
self.checkTest()
def test_curved_placement_online(self):
# Curved placement, on line
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Curved
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.OnLine
self.checkTest()
def test_curved_placement_above(self):
# Curved placement, on line
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Curved
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.AboveLine | QgsPalLayerSettings.MapOrientation
self.checkTest()
def test_curved_placement_below(self):
# Curved placement, on line
self.lyr.placement = QgsPalLayerSettings.Curved
self.lyr.placementFlags = QgsPalLayerSettings.BelowLine | QgsPalLayerSettings.MapOrientation
self.checkTest()
# noinspection PyPep8Naming
def suiteTests():
"""
Use to define which tests are run when PAL_SUITE is set.
Use sp_vs_suite for comparison of server and composer outputs to canvas
"""
sp_suite = [
# 'test_default_label',
# 'test_text_size_map_unit',
# 'test_text_color',
# 'test_background_rect',
# 'test_background_rect_w_offset',
# 'test_background_svg',
# 'test_background_svg_w_offset',
# 'test_partials_labels_enabled',
# 'test_partials_labels_disabled',
]
sp_vs_suite = [
#'test_something_specific',
]
# extended separately for finer control of PAL_SUITE (comment-out undesired)
sp_vs_suite.extend(sp_suite)
return {
'sp_suite': sp_suite,
'sp_vs_suite': sp_vs_suite
}
if __name__ == '__main__':
pass
